Fun Fact: The first Tim Hortons location in North Bay, Ontario sold hamburgers. It rebranded and opened under the name Tim Hortons Donuts on May 17, 1964.
On this day
In 1922, it snows on Mauna Loa, the largest mountain in Hawaii.
In 1969, the first flight of a Boeing 747 takes off.
In 1997, 鈥楾he Simpsons鈥 becomes the longest running animated series with their 167th episode. (Still running today, they are currently at 740 episodes.)
In 2018, the Winter Olympic games open in PyeongChang.
In 2021, impeachment trial for former President Donald Trump begins.
